CVE-2025-2776 (SysAid On-Prem)

Description:  Vulnerability enabling administrator takeover via XML-based exploits. Technical Details: CVSS Score: 9.2 (Critical) Exploit: Attackers exploit weak XML validation to inject payloads that modify role_id fields (<user><role_id>admin</role_id></user>), escalating to admin privileges. The attack targets /api/v1/admin endpoints, chaining with CVE-2025-2775 for initial data access.
